Prime Minister directs to push back black credit and loan sharking
Many lending activities have high interest rates, up to 700% a year, to gain illegal profits, causing social instability.
The Prime Minister has just issued Directive 12 on strengthening the prevention and fight against illegal credit. According to the Government's assessment, illegal credit in many localities has affected security and order with very sophisticated and complicated tricks.
These subjects take advantage of telecommunications networks, the Internet, disguise themselves as businesses with financial lending functions, debt collection services, pawn businesses, create a cover, deal with authorities to lend without mortgage. Financial business, contribute capital, contribute business assets with very high interest rates, 100-300%, even up to 700% a year to gain illegal profits.
To combat this situation, the Prime Minister requested the Ministry of Public Security to direct the police of provinces and cities to inspect pawnshops, debt collection services and other businesses that show signs of usury and debt collection activities. At the same time, tighten the issuance of certificates and strengthen management and inspection of pawnshops and debt collection shops; revoke certificates of security and order eligibility for establishments that violate the regulations.
The Ministry of Public Security is required to launch peak attacks and crackdowns on crimes nationwide and in cyberspace related to illegal credit activities, in conjunction with the fight against and eradication of gambling rings and property fraud through forms of capital mobilization, participation in savings and credit associations, etc.

Regarding the State Bank, the Prime Minister directed to strengthen propaganda, promote maximum mobilization of idle capital among the people; promote online lending and payment services and simplify lending procedures so that all people can easily access legal loans.
The State Bank issues or advises the Government and the Prime Minister on policies to diversify loan types and banking products and services; develop financial companies and microfinance organizations... to meet people's borrowing needs.
At the same time, this agency needs to promote the maximum mobilization of idle capital among the people, promote the potential and internal strength of the economy; promote the application of science and technology, and develop online lending and payment services.
Tightly control pawnshop and debt collection service businesses
The Prime Minister also assigned the Ministry of Planning and Investment to strictly control business registration, pawnshop and debt collection service business households, and coordinate with the police force in issuing certificates of eligibility for security and order.
The Prime Minister requested the People's Committees of provinces and cities to direct and promulgate social security policies, create jobs for workers, prevent black credit and illegal acts, social evils and crimes.
Local leaders and agencies and units mobilize people to proactively detect and prevent subjects from distributing, posting leaflets, and painting advertisements related to high-interest loans; debt collectors from dumping dirt and waste, causing insecurity and disorder. Remove and erase leaflets and billboards posted or hung on walls, electric poles, trees, etc. about financial loans and pawning, affecting urban aesthetics, traffic safety, and society.
People's Committees of centrally-run cities and provinces direct business registration agencies to issue business and household registration certificates in accordance with regulations; and revoke business licenses of black credit lending establishments.
Prohibit civil servants from contributing capital, mobilizing capital, brokering, covering up, and assisting in illegal lending, loan sharking, establishing businesses, financial households, pawn services, debt collection... in violation of the law. If discovered, violators will be severely punished.
